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@

import django.db.models.deletion
from cryptography.fernet import Fernet
from django.db import migrations, models
from django.db import connection, migrations, models


def fill_with_default_x2text(apps, schema):
Expand Down Expand Up @@ -35,6 +35,13 @@ def reversal_x2text(*args):
"""Reversal is NOOP since x2text is simply dropped during reverse."""


def disable_triggers(apps, schema_editor):
with connection.cursor() as cursor:
cursor.execute(
"ALTER TABLE adapter_adapterinstance DISABLE TRIGGER ALL;"
)


class Migration(migrations.Migration):
dependencies = [
("account", "0005_encryptionsecret"),
Expand All @@ -50,6 +57,9 @@ class Migration(migrations.Migration):
model_name="profilemanager",
name="pdf_to_text_converters",
),
migrations.RunPython(
disable_triggers, reverse_code=migrations.RunPython.noop
),
migrations.AddField(
model_name="profilemanager",
name="x2text",
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,14 @@
# Generated by Django 4.2.1 on 2024-02-23 17:02

import django.db.models.deletion
from django.db import migrations, models
from django.db import connection, migrations, models


def enable_triggers(apps, schema_editor):
with connection.cursor() as cursor:
cursor.execute(
"ALTER TABLE adapter_adapterinstance ENABLE TRIGGER ALL;"
)


class Migration(migrations.Migration):
Expand All @@ -24,4 +31,7 @@ class Migration(migrations.Migration):
to="adapter_processor.adapterinstance",
),
),
migrations.RunPython(
enable_triggers,
),
]